Teton Village

Teton Village is the valley market where marketing language and legal form are most likely to diverge. Ski proximity can be obvious; the ownership right behind it may be an ordinary condominium, a lodging unit, a managed residence, a fractional interest or a detached home subject to an entirely different regime.

Start with the interest, not the building

The first question in Teton Village is what is being conveyed. A deed can transfer a whole unit, an interval, an undivided interest, a parking or storage appurtenance or a residence operating within a lodging program. Branding and front-desk presentation do not answer that question; declarations, maps, amendments and management documents do.

This is why Teton Village sales cannot be fed into one condominium index. Ordinary residential units, lodging condominiums, fractional interests and detached houses have different use patterns, buyer pools and expense structures. Preserving each transaction is important; mixing them is not.

Ski access must be stated precisely

“Ski-in/ski-out” can describe physical adjacency, a trail, a revocable operating pattern, a private easement or a marketing convention. A durable property statement identifies the route, the recorded or operating basis for access, seasonal conditions and whether the right belongs to the subject interest.

The same precision applies to amenities. Hotel services, clubs, spas, parking, shuttle arrangements and owner storage can be included, optional, separately contracted or subject to operating rules. They should be underwritten as rights and obligations rather than atmosphere.

Resort governance is a second title layer

Teton Village planning sits within County jurisdiction and resort-specific plans, while individual assets sit within private regimes and service districts. The acquisition file must therefore connect public approvals to private governance. A permitted use does not override a declaration; an association permission does not create zoning authority.

Financial review should follow the same structure: association expenses, resort or management charges, reserve obligations, insurance, rental distributions and capital projects should be attributed to the correct entity. A single monthly number can conceal several contractual relationships.

The village thesis

Teton Village scarcity is real, but scarcity alone does not make unlike interests comparable. The most durable value belongs to a clearly documented ownership position whose access, use, services and costs match the buyer's intended pattern.

The Research Desk treats that legal-operating fit as the central resort property question—not an appendix to the view.
